ABSTRACT:
An on-edge stacking machine having a mailpiece input device to release mailpieces, one at a time, to a stacking deck for stacking. A speed monitoring device and a sensing device are used to monitor the moving speed and the arrival time of a mailpiece from the input device to a reference point of the stacking machine. Based on the moving speed and the arrival time, a displacement distance of the arriving mailpiece is computed. A segmented roller is then used to move the arriving mailpiece into the bottom of the stack in a two-part motion cycle, based on the displacement of the arriving mailpiece.
